La Puente Nuevo
Standing majestically across the gargantuan El Tajo Gorge, La Puente Nuevo is more than just a monument. It embodies Ronda's storied history, acting as a symbol of its enduring tenacity. Erected in the 18th century after its predecessor was destroyed, La Puente Nuevo's arched design stands as a testament to the craftsmanship of its creators.
Currently it is a must-see for visitors, offering breathtaking vistas and a window into Ronda's captivating past.

Discovering the Treasures of Ronda, Spain
Nestled tranquilly in the heart of Andalusia, Ronda is a charming Spanish town with a rich history. Its breathtaking scenery and ancient architecture will enchant every visitor.
One of the most iconic sights in Ronda is the Puente Nuevo, a grand bridge that connects the two dramatic gorges. From here, you can enjoy panoramic views of the adjacent countryside.
Another attraction is the Plaza de Toros, one of the oldest and grandest bullrings in Spain.
Ronda also boasts a range of charming cobblestone streets, unveiled squares, and traditional whitewashed houses.
